The Role of Game Developers
Several key companies are at the forefront of developing live casino games. Evolution Gaming is arguably the industry leader, known for its wide array of games, innovative features, and high production values. Other prominent developers include Playtech, NetEnt Live, and Extreme Live Gaming. These companies invest heavily in research and development to create increasingly immersive and engaging experiences for players. They continually introduce new game variations, interactive features, and enhanced visuals. The competition among these developers drives innovation and ultimately benefits the player with a richer and more diverse selection of games. These developers also ensure the games are regularly audited for fairness.

Strategies for Successful Live Casino Gaming
While luck undoubtedly plays a role in casino games, employing strategic thinking can significantly improve your chances of success. In Live Blackjack, mastering basic strategy is crucial. This involves understanding the optimal way to play each hand based on your cards and the dealer's upcard. Card counting is possible, although often discouraged by casinos. For Roulette, understanding the different betting options and their associated odds is essential. Betting on outside chances, such as red/black or odd/even, offers higher probabilities of winning but lower payouts. Baccarat relies heavily on understanding the house edge associated with different bets; the Banker bet offers the lowest house edge, but often comes with a commission.
Effective bankroll management is paramount in any form of gambling, but particularly important in live casino games. Set a budget for your session and stick to it, avoiding the temptation to chase losses. Start with smaller bets and gradually increase them as you gain confidence and experience. Knowing when to quit is just as important as knowing when to play. Don’t get caught up in the excitement of the game and make impulsive decisions. Remember, the house always has an edge, so responsible play is the key to enjoying the experience without risking financial ruin.

Navigating Regulatory Landscapes and Responsible Gaming
As the popularity of live online casinos continues to grow, so too does the scrutiny from regulatory bodies. Different jurisdictions have varying levels of regulation, and it’s essential that operators adhere to these standards to ensure fair play and protect consumers. Licensing requirements, security protocols, and anti-money laundering measures are all key aspects of regulatory compliance. Players should only play at casinos that are licensed and regulated by reputable authorities. This ensures that the casino is operating legally and ethically. Transparent terms and conditions are also vital, outlining the rules of the game, payout percentages, and dispute resolution mechanisms.
Equally important is the promotion of responsible gaming. Casinos have a duty of care to protect vulnerable players and prevent problem gambling. This includes implementing features such as de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and access to support resources. Players themselves should also be aware of the risks associated with gambling and take steps to protect themselves. Setting time limits, playing only with disposable income, and seeking help if they feel they are losing control are all crucial aspects of responsible gaming. The industry is increasingly recognizing the importance of responsible practices, alongside technological advancement, to foster a sustainable and ethical environment for all.
